The Center for Quantum Computing (CQC) is hiring a Software Development Manager to lead a team of software engineers building applications and infrastructure that support our quantum device fabrication facility. You will own the software stack powering our Manufacturing Execution System, ML-driven inspection systems, and LLM-powered research tools. You will work closely with Scientists, Hardware Engineers, Process Engineers, and Technical Program Managers. This is a hands-on technical leadership role, you will assume a technical lead’s responsibilities by setting architectural direction, making key strategic design decisions for the team’s stack.
Responsibilities
Hire, develop, and retain a high-performing team of software engineers; set technical direction through hands-on involvement in architecture, design and code reviews.
Work directly with scientists and engineers to understand their problems and propose workable solutions. Translate user stories into software design documents demonstrating sensible trade-offs between complexity and delivery.
Partner with fabrication engineers, research scientists, and program management to define roadmaps translating research needs into software capabilities
Drive ML-powered initiatives including automated optical inspection systems that detect and classify defects on wafers
Lead LLM integration projects enabling scientists to query, visualize, and analyze fabrication data through natural language interfaces and autonomous agents
